An architect these days learn to draw (most of the time in AutoCad). These are technical drawings. This is not the kind you do as a kid in school. For visualisation of the future house/ office, 3D computer drawing is learned. Models are also made with balsa wood and kartboard.

In general they learn some Statica (physica) to understand the measures all elements need to have. Sometimes a finite element model is used to calculate the strength of the building. Allthough this is for the more exotic building which you and i probably dont live in. (Most of the time a building engineer calculates the architects design)
